In science, a tracking device is a tool or technology used to monitor the movement or location of an object or organism. This can include instruments like GPS devices, radio transmitters, or RFID tags that provide data on the position and trajectory of the tracked entity. Tracking devices are commonly used in fields such as ecology, wildlife biology, and geology to study patterns of movement and behavior.

A catapult's trajectory refers to the path followed by the projectile launched by the catapult. It is typically parabolic in shape, with the highest point of the trajectory known as the apex. The trajectory is influenced by factors such as the launch angle, initial velocity, and gravitational pull.

Surgery robots are typically equipped with various sensors, including cameras for high-definition visual feedback, force sensors to measure tissue resistance during manipulation, and haptic sensors that provide tactile feedback to the surgeon. Additionally, some systems may include infrared sensors for tracking instruments and electromagnetic sensors for precise positioning. These sensors work together to enhance precision, safety, and control during surgical procedures.
